[发明专利]基于扩散曲线的RGBD图像矢量化方法有效
申请号: | 201610900994.1 | 申请日: | 2016-10-17 |
公开(公告)号: | CN106504294B | 公开(公告)日: | 2019-04-26 |
发明(设计)人: | 卢书芳;蒋炜;蔡历;高飞;毛家发 | 申请(专利权)人: | 浙江工业大学 |
主分类号: | G06T9/00 | 分类号: | G06T9/00;G06T7/50;G06T7/10 |
代理公司: | 杭州浙科专利事务所(普通合伙) 33213 | 代理人: | 周红芳 |
地址: | 310014 浙江省杭*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了基于扩散曲线的RGBD图像矢量化方法,它包括输入待处理的原始RGB彩色图像和深度图像D,对RGB图像进行多尺度Canny边缘提取,对获得的多尺度二值边缘图像着色生成彩色边缘图像,修复深度图像,对修复后的深度图D’进行深度边缘提取生成深度边缘图像,将两个边缘图像相减得到细节边缘图像,对细节边缘图像和深度边缘图像进行追踪合并生成一组折线段,对折线段进行颜色采样和贝塞尔曲线拟合得到一组扩散曲线,以曲线上的颜色为约束求解泊松方程得到矢量化结果九个步骤。本发明采用了RGBD图像来获得其物体轮廓,更好的还原了物体的真实轮廓,解决了某些颜色环境下多尺度Canny失效的情况。本发明算法明确,结果鲁棒,适用于RGBD图像的矢量化。 | ||
搜索关键词: | 基于 扩散 曲线 rgbd 图像 矢量 方法 | ||
【主权项】:
1.基于扩散曲线的RGBD图像矢量化方法,其特征在于该方法包括以下步骤:1)输入RGB彩色图像和对应的深度图D,等待处理;2)将步骤1)中等待处理的RGB彩色图像进行多尺度Canny边缘提取,得到多尺度二值边缘图像;3)对步骤2)中的多尺度二值边缘图像采用着色算法,得到彩色边缘图像;4)将步骤1)中的深度图D进行深度修复,得到修复后的深度图D';5)对步骤4)中修复后的深度图D'采用深度边缘提取算法,得到深度边缘图像;6)将步骤3)中的彩色边缘图像和步骤5)中的深度边缘图像进行相减,得到细节边缘图像;7)对步骤5)的深度边缘图像和步骤6)中的细节边缘图像进行像素链跟踪合并,得到一组折线段,所述像素链跟踪合并方法如下:步骤7‑1,对于细节边缘图和深度边缘图中的每一条像素链,实施如下算法得到折线段:步骤7‑1‑1,找到像素链的其中一个端点x,在x的上、下、左、右四个优先方向寻找可连接像素,若优先方向上不存在可连接像素,则在左上,左下、右上、右下次优方向上寻找可连接像素,若存在多个可连接像素,则选取能与当前像素组成最长线段的方向作为可连接方向,在可连接方向上找到该方向上的拐点像素,将其位置记录下;步骤7‑1‑2,将x指向步骤7‑1‑1中找到的拐点像素;步骤7‑1‑3,重步骤7‑1‑1和步骤7‑1‑2,直到x指向该像素链的另一个端点y;步骤7‑2,将细节边缘图生成的折线段集合和深度边缘图生成的折线段集合进行合并;步骤7‑3,为了增强边缘的连续性,将2个像素的距离且端点处的颜色偏差值小于一定阈值的折线段相连接,形成更长的折线段,其颜色偏差值计算函数如下:其中a和b为像素端点,Ra,Ga,Ba分别表示a处的红色通道、绿色通道和蓝色通道的值,Rb,Gb,Bb分别表示b处的红色通道,绿色通道和蓝色通道的值;8)对步骤7)中的折线段进行颜色采样和贝塞尔曲线拟合,得到一组扩散曲线;9)通过求解以步骤8)中扩散曲线上的颜色为约束的泊松方程,平滑地将颜色扩散并填满整个图像空间,得到矢量化结果。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于浙江工业大学,未经浙江工业大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201610900994.1/,转载请声明来源钻瓜专利网。